This morning our Year 6 pupils took a closer look at onions. Using iodine they stained their preparations of onion, making it possible to see the structures of the cells under a microscope. The pupils were all very excited to see who had the clearest view of the cells and share their results with Mr Aribigbola. 🔬🧬🥼
